<title>PCI: vmd: Disable MSI remapping bypass under Xen</title>
<updated>2025-05-29T09:02:09+00:00</updated>
<author>
<name>Roger Pau Monne</name>
<email>roger.pau@citrix.com</email>
</author>
<published>2025-02-19T09:20:56+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=2a8bedeb963f04d13b782e099c7db3d2f62a056e'/>
<id>urn:sha1:2a8bedeb963f04d13b782e099c7db3d2f62a056e</id>
<content type='text'>
[ Upstream commit 6c4d5aadf5df31ea0ac025980670eee9beaf466b ]

MSI remapping bypass (directly configuring MSI entries for devices on the
VMD bus) won't work under Xen, as Xen is not aware of devices in such bus,
and hence cannot configure the entries using the pIRQ interface in the PV
case, and in the PVH case traps won't be setup for MSI entries for such
devices.

Until Xen is aware of devices in the VMD bus prevent the
VMD_FEAT_CAN_BYPASS_MSI_REMAP capability from being used when running as
any kind of Xen guest.

The MSI remapping bypass is an optional feature of VMD bridges, and hence
when running under Xen it will be masked and devices will be forced to
redirect its interrupts from the VMD bridge.  That mode of operation must
always be supported by VMD bridges and works when Xen is not aware of
devices behind the VMD bridge.

<title>PCI: vmd: Make vmd_dev::cfg_lock a raw_spinlock_t type</title>
<updated>2025-04-20T08:15:26+00:00</updated>
<author>
<name>Ryo Takakura</name>
<email>ryotkkr98@gmail.com</email>
</author>
<published>2025-02-18T08:08:30+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=5c3cfcf0b4bf43530788b08a8eaf7896ec567484'/>
<id>urn:sha1:5c3cfcf0b4bf43530788b08a8eaf7896ec567484</id>
<content type='text'>
[ Upstream commit 18056a48669a040bef491e63b25896561ee14d90 ]

The access to the PCI config space via pci_ops::read and pci_ops::write is
a low-level hardware access. The functions can be accessed with disabled
interrupts even on PREEMPT_RT. The pci_lock is a raw_spinlock_t for this
purpose.

A spinlock_t becomes a sleeping lock on PREEMPT_RT, so it cannot be
acquired with disabled interrupts. The vmd_dev::cfg_lock is accessed in
the same context as the pci_lock.

Make vmd_dev::cfg_lock a raw_spinlock_t type so it can be used with
interrupts disabled.

This was reported as:

  BUG: sleeping function called from invalid context at kernel/locking/spinlock_rt.c:48
  Call Trace:
   rt_spin_lock+0x4e/0x130
   vmd_pci_read+0x8d/0x100 [vmd]
   pci_user_read_config_byte+0x6f/0xe0
   pci_read_config+0xfe/0x290
   sysfs_kf_bin_read+0x68/0x90

<title>PCI: vmd: Silence 'set affinity failed' warning</title>
<updated>2024-08-06T17:52:03+00:00</updated>
<author>
<name>Marek Vasut</name>
<email>marek.vasut+renesas@mailbox.org</email>
</author>
<published>2024-07-23T13:27:12+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=647e9651a0110fb0ff163ef6bf1318b30f90a08c'/>
<id>urn:sha1:647e9651a0110fb0ff163ef6bf1318b30f90a08c</id>
<content type='text'>
Use MSI_FLAG_NO_AFFINITY, which keeps .irq_set_affinity() unset and allows
migrate_one_irq() to exit right away, without warnings like this:

  IRQ...: set affinity failed(-22)

Remove the .irq_set_affinity() implementation that is no longer needed.

<title>PCI: vmd: Create domain symlink before pci_bus_add_devices()</title>
<updated>2024-07-10T21:55:06+00:00</updated>
<author>
<name>Jiwei Sun</name>
<email>sunjw10@lenovo.com</email>
</author>
<published>2024-06-05T12:48:44+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=f24c9bfcd423e2b2bb0d198456412f614ec2030a'/>
<id>urn:sha1:f24c9bfcd423e2b2bb0d198456412f614ec2030a</id>
<content type='text'>
The vmd driver creates a "domain" symlink in sysfs for each VMD bridge.
Previously this symlink was created after pci_bus_add_devices() added
devices below the VMD bridge and emitted udev events to announce them to
userspace.

This led to a race between userspace consumers of the udev events and the
kernel creation of the symlink.  One such consumer is mdadm, which
assembles block devices into a RAID array, and for devices below a VMD
bridge, mdadm depends on the "domain" symlink.

If mdadm loses the race, it may be unable to assemble a RAID array, which
may cause a boot failure or other issues, with complaints like this:

  (udev-worker)[2149]: nvme1n1: '/sbin/mdadm -I /dev/nvme1n1'(err) 'mdadm: Unable to get real path for '/sys/bus/pci/drivers/vmd/0000:c7:00.5/domain/device''
  (udev-worker)[2149]: nvme1n1: '/sbin/mdadm -I /dev/nvme1n1'(err) 'mdadm: /dev/nvme1n1 is not attached to Intel(R) RAID controller.'
  (udev-worker)[2149]: nvme1n1: '/sbin/mdadm -I /dev/nvme1n1'(err) 'mdadm: No OROM/EFI properties for /dev/nvme1n1'
  (udev-worker)[2149]: nvme1n1: '/sbin/mdadm -I /dev/nvme1n1'(err) 'mdadm: no RAID superblock on /dev/nvme1n1.'
  (udev-worker)[2149]: nvme1n1: Process '/sbin/mdadm -I /dev/nvme1n1' failed with exit code 1.

This symptom prevents the OS from booting successfully.

After a NVMe disk is probed/added by the nvme driver, udevd invokes mdadm
to detect if there is a mdraid associated with this NVMe disk, and mdadm
determines if a NVMe device is connected to a particular VMD domain by
checking the "domain" symlink. For example:

  Thread A                   Thread B             Thread mdadm
  vmd_enable_domain
    pci_bus_add_devices
      __driver_probe_device
       ...
       work_on_cpu
         schedule_work_on
         : wakeup Thread B
                             nvme_probe
                             : wakeup scan_work
                               to scan nvme disk
                               and add nvme disk
                               then wakeup udevd
                                                  : udevd executes
                                                    mdadm command
         flush_work                               main
         : wait for nvme_probe done                ...
      __driver_probe_device                        find_driver_devices
      : probe next nvme device                     : 1) Detect domain symlink
      ...                                            2) Find domain symlink
      ...                                               from vmd sysfs
      ...                                            3) Domain symlink not
      ...                                               created yet; failed
    sysfs_create_link
    : create domain symlink

Create the VMD "domain" symlink before invoking pci_bus_add_devices() to
avoid this race.
